€30,00 restaurant Accident Compensation for Girl (3) Injured by Table Blown in the Wind

Following suffering a broken nose when a table blew over outside a restaurant, a three-year-old girl has been awarded €30,000 damages in the Circuit Civil Court.

Legal representative for Lily Spratt, who is now five years old, Barrister Ivan Daly said that she had been injured when a table in an outdoors seating area hit her face after being blown in the wind outside an O’Brien’s Sandwich Bar, at Lower Grand Canal Street, Dublin.

Mr Daly told Circuit Court President, Mr Justice Raymond Groarke, that the girl was treated, following the accident, at Temple Street Children’s Hospital where her nose had been repaired. During the procedure Lily had been place under general anaesthetic.

The restaurant injury compensation action was taken against Adleo Limited through Lily’s mother, Emma Kelly, York Road, Ringsend, Dublin 4. Lily has since completely recovered from the injuries that she suffered in the accident that happened during April 2018.

Mr Daly told the court that the young girl had suffered no permanent damage to her nose. He said: “Certainly there is no question of any disfigurement of her nose.” he was recommending that the court accept the settlement offer that was being made by Adleo Ltd.

    Presiding Judge Judge Groarke gave his approval to the restaurant accident compensation settlement as he thought it to be a very good offer.
